import { TextToImageParams } from "@livepeer/ai/models/components";
let value: TextToImageParams = {
prompt: "<value>",
};
Field | Type | Required | Description |
---|---|---|---|
modelId |
string | ➖ | Hugging Face model ID used for image generation. |
loras |
string | ➖ | A LoRA (Low-Rank Adaptation) model and its corresponding weight for image generation. Example: { "latent-consistency/lcm-lora-sdxl": 1.0, "nerijs/pixel-art-xl": 1.2}. |
prompt |
string | ✔️ | Text prompt(s) to guide image generation. Separate multiple prompts with '|' if supported by the model. |
height |
number | ➖ | The height in pixels of the generated image. |
width |
number | ➖ | The width in pixels of the generated image. |
guidanceScale |
number | ➖ | Encourages model to generate images closely linked to the text prompt (higher values may reduce image quality). |
negativePrompt |
string | ➖ | Text prompt(s) to guide what to exclude from image generation. Ignored if guidance_scale < 1. |
safetyCheck |
boolean | ➖ | Perform a safety check to estimate if generated images could be offensive or harmful. |
seed |
number | ➖ | Seed for random number generation. |
numInferenceSteps |
number | ➖ | Number of denoising steps. More steps usually lead to higher quality images but slower inference. Modulated by strength. |
numImagesPerPrompt |
number | ➖ | Number of images to generate per prompt. |